Q: Is 2,353,153 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,353,153 is a composite number.

Why is 2,353,153 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,353,153 can be evenly divided by 1 11 23 71 131 253 781 1,441 1,633 3,013 9,301 17,963 33,143 102,311 213,923 and 2,353,153, with no remainder.

Since 2,353,153 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,353,153, it is a composite number.
